Output 5c28796bd906f0654cc0bfd329672e82cfab777530f390aa0c22a05d79061524:1

value
40623696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ad092fafd11d68be4363a58ee07ab392a66b463c OP_EQUAL
address
3HTwq1C38ALBHY8UNTdVgZLhXuLmCnpKay
transaction
5c28796bd906f0654cc0bfd329672e82cfab777530f390aa0c22a05d79061524
spent
true